Mercurial > repos > IBBoard.WarFoundry.GUI.WinForms
annotate FrmMain.resx @ 237:ea5cb50ebe5e
Fixes #384: Validation warnings don't get cleared when creating new armies
* Check whether army is valid when it changes (also means we validate on load as well as clearing on close)
author | IBBoard <dev@ibboard.co.uk> |
---|---|
date | Sat, 21 Jan 2012 16:51:07 +0000 |
parents | 5233147ca7e4 |
children |
rev | line source |
---|---|
127
c89d0cb4b893
Re #88: Complete initial WinForms UI
IBBoard <dev@ibboard.co.uk>
parents:
126
diff
changeset
|
1 <?xml version="1.0" encoding="utf-8"?> |
0 | 2 <root> |
3 <!-- | |
4 Microsoft ResX Schema | |
5 | |
6 Version 2.0 | |
7 | |
8 The primary goals of this format is to allow a simple XML format | |
9 that is mostly human readable. The generation and parsing of the | |
10 various data types are done through the TypeConverter classes | |
11 associated with the data types. | |
12 | |
13 Example: | |
14 | |
15 ... ado.net/XML headers & schema ... | |
16 <resheader name="resmimetype">text/microsoft-resx</resheader> | |
17 <resheader name="version">2.0</resheader> | |
18 <resheader name="reader">System.Resources.ResXResourceReader, System.Windows.Forms, ...</resheader> | |
19 <resheader name="writer">System.Resources.ResXResourceWriter, System.Windows.Forms, ...</resheader> | |
20 <data name="Name1"><value>this is my long string</value><comment>this is a comment</comment></data> | |
21 <data name="Color1" type="System.Drawing.Color, System.Drawing">Blue</data> | |
22 <data name="Bitmap1" mimetype="application/x-microsoft.net.object.binary.base64"> | |
23 <value>[base64 mime encoded serialized .NET Framework object]</value> | |
24 </data> | |
25 <data name="Icon1" type="System.Drawing.Icon, System.Drawing" mimetype="application/x-microsoft.net.object.bytearray.base64"> | |
26 <value>[base64 mime encoded string representing a byte array form of the .NET Framework object]</value> | |
27 <comment>This is a comment</comment> | |
28 </data> | |
29 | |
30 There are any number of "resheader" rows that contain simple | |
31 name/value pairs. | |
32 | |
33 Each data row contains a name, and value. The row also contains a | |
34 type or mimetype. Type corresponds to a .NET class that support | |
35 text/value conversion through the TypeConverter architecture. | |
36 Classes that don't support this are serialized and stored with the | |
37 mimetype set. | |
38 | |
39 The mimetype is used for serialized objects, and tells the | |
40 ResXResourceReader how to depersist the object. This is currently not | |
41 extensible. For a given mimetype the value must be set accordingly: | |
42 | |
43 Note - application/x-microsoft.net.object.binary.base64 is the format | |
44 that the ResXResourceWriter will generate, however the reader can | |
45 read any of the formats listed below. | |
46 | |
47 mimetype: application/x-microsoft.net.object.binary.base64 | |
48 value : The object must be serialized with | |
49 : System.Runtime.Serialization.Formatters.Binary.BinaryFormatter | |
50 : and then encoded with base64 encoding. | |
51 | |
52 mimetype: application/x-microsoft.net.object.soap.base64 | |
53 value : The object must be serialized with | |
54 : System.Runtime.Serialization.Formatters.Soap.SoapFormatter | |
55 : and then encoded with base64 encoding. | |
56 | |
57 mimetype: application/x-microsoft.net.object.bytearray.base64 | |
58 value : The object must be serialized into a byte array | |
59 : using a System.ComponentModel.TypeConverter | |
60 : and then encoded with base64 encoding. | |
61 --> | |
62 <xsd:schema id="root" xmlns=""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:msdata="urn:schemas-microsoft-com:xml-msdata"> | |
63 <xsd:import namespace="http://www.w3.org/XML/1998/namespace" /> | |
64 <xsd:element name="root" msdata:IsDataSet="true"> | |
65 <xsd:complexType> | |
66 <xsd:choice maxOccurs="unbounded"> | |
67 <xsd:element name="metadata"> | |
68 <xsd:complexType> | |
69 <xsd:sequence> | |
70 <xsd:element name="value" type="xsd:string" minOccurs="0" /> | |
71 </xsd:sequence> | |
72 <xsd:attribute name="name" use="required" type="xsd:string" /> | |
73 <xsd:attribute name="type" type="xsd:string" /> | |
74 <xsd:attribute name="mimetype" type="xsd:string" /> | |
75 <xsd:attribute ref="xml:space" /> | |
76 </xsd:complexType> | |
77 </xsd:element> | |
78 <xsd:element name="assembly"> | |
79 <xsd:complexType> | |
80 <xsd:attribute name="alias" type="xsd:string" /> | |
81 <xsd:attribute name="name" type="xsd:string" /> | |
82 </xsd:complexType> | |
83 </xsd:element> | |
84 <xsd:element name="data"> | |
85 <xsd:complexType> | |
86 <xsd:sequence> | |
87 <xsd:element name="value" type="xsd:string" minOccurs="0" msdata:Ordinal="1" /> | |
88 <xsd:element name="comment" type="xsd:string" minOccurs="0" msdata:Ordinal="2" /> | |
89 </xsd:sequence> | |
90 <xsd:attribute name="name" type="xsd:string" use="required" msdata:Ordinal="1" /> | |
91 <xsd:attribute name="type" type="xsd:string" msdata:Ordinal="3" /> | |
92 <xsd:attribute name="mimetype" type="xsd:string" msdata:Ordinal="4" /> | |
93 <xsd:attribute ref="xml:space" /> | |
94 </xsd:complexType> | |
95 </xsd:element> | |
96 <xsd:element name="resheader"> | |
97 <xsd:complexType> | |
98 <xsd:sequence> | |
99 <xsd:element name="value" type="xsd:string" minOccurs="0" msdata:Ordinal="1" /> | |
100 </xsd:sequence> | |
101 <xsd:attribute name="name" type="xsd:string" use="required" /> | |
102 </xsd:complexType> | |
103 </xsd:element> | |
104 </xsd:choice> | |
105 </xsd:complexType> | |
106 </xsd:element> | |
107 </xsd:schema> | |
108 <resheader name="resmimetype"> | |
109 <value>text/microsoft-resx</value> | |
110 </resheader> | |
111 <resheader name="version"> | |
112 <value>2.0</value> | |
113 </resheader> | |
114 <resheader name="reader"> | |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
115 <value>System.Resources.ResXResourceReader, System.Windows.Forms,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089</value> |
0 | 116 </resheader> |
117 <resheader name="writer"> | |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
118 <value>System.Resources.ResXResourceWriter, System.Windows.Forms,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089</value> |
0 | 119 </resheader> |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
120 <metadata name="undoMenu.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"> |
0 | 121 <value>17, 17</value> |
122 </metadata> | |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
123 <metadata name="redoMenu.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"> |
0 | 124 <value>122, 17</value> |
125 </metadata> | |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
126 <metadata name="mainMenu.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"> |
0 | 127 <value>334, 17</value> |
128 </metadata> | |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
129 <metadata name="openArmyDialog.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"> |
0 | 130 <value>438, 17</value> |
131 </metadata> | |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
132 <metadata name="saveArmyDialog.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"> |
0 | 133 <value>573, 17</value> |
134 </metadata> | |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
135 <metadata name="menuStrip.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"> |
123
ff931ff5891c
Re #88: Complete initial WinForms UI
IBBoard <dev@ibboard.co.uk>
parents:
0
diff
changeset
|
136 <value>835, 17</value> |
ff931ff5891c
Re #88: Complete initial WinForms UI
IBBoard <dev@ibboard.co.uk>
parents:
0
diff
changeset
|
137 </metadata> |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
138 <metadata name="mainToolStrip.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"> |
124
4acfce15b222
Re #88: Complete initial WinForms UI
IBBoard <dev@ibboard.co.uk>
parents:
123
diff
changeset
|
139 <value>17, 54</value> |
4acfce15b222
Re #88: Complete initial WinForms UI
IBBoard <dev@ibboard.co.uk>
parents:
123
diff
changeset
|
140 </metadata> |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
141 <metadata name="catToolStrip.TrayLocation" type="System.Drawing.Point, System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a"> |
126
25c989ef2a8d
Re #88: Complete initial WinForms UI
IBBoard <dev@ibboard.co.uk>
parents:
124
diff
changeset
|
142 <value>138, 54</value> |
25c989ef2a8d
Re #88: Complete initial WinForms UI
IBBoard <dev@ibboard.co.uk>
parents:
124
diff
changeset
|
143 </metadata> |
221
5233147ca7e4
Re #101: Make army names and sizes modifiable after creation
IBBoard <dev@ibboard.co.uk>
parents:
207
diff
changeset
|
144 <assembly alias="System.Drawing" name="System.Drawing,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a" /> |
0 | 145 <data name="$this.Icon" type="System.Drawing.Icon, System.Drawing" mimetype="application/x-microsoft.net.object.bytearray.base64"> |
146 <value> | |
147 AAABAAEAEBAAAAEAIABoBAAAFgAAACgAAAAQAAAAIAAAAAEAIAAAAAAAAAAAABMLAAATCwAAAAAAAAAA | |
148 AABOTk4jTVBP/4yQjv+Hi4n/VlpY/2JmZf95fnz/goeF/4WKiP+Fioj/hYqI/4WKiP+Fioj/VVhW/05O | |
149 TgEAAAAATk5OIlVYV//T1tb/2N7c/7rAvf9+goD/XmBf/5mZmf+rq6v/sbGx/7Gxsf+ysrL/q6ur/3h8 | |
150 e/9MTEwXTk5OBU5OThFSVVT/a21s/8XJyP/W29n/zdTR/6mtq/9+f37/o6Oi/9LS0v/m5ub/6enp/5OT | |
151 k/9FSEb/Ojs6iU5OTiBOTk4EfIF//8bGxv9ydHP/jJCO/8nNzP/V29r/wsjG/42Rj/9wcXD/tLS0/9XV | |
152 1f9zdHT/kpaU/2ttbPozNDN6AAAAAIWKiP/5+fn/1dXV/5ydnf9gYWD/kJKP/8vPzf/R2NX/usC+/3x+ | |
153 ff+ZmZn/UFBQ/7S5t//AxML/VVdWrQAAAACFioj//////9nZ2f+pqan/m5ub/4ODgv9mZWT/pael/87T | |
154 0f/K0c7/naGg/4CDgv/M0s//kZWU+0VGRYUAAAAAhYqI///////s7Oz/7Ozs/+rq6v/i4uL/ysrK/3Ny | |
155 cf9gYF//tLe1/5yfnf+2u7n/vMHA/1tbWPg9PTqdAAAAAIWKiP//////29vb/7Gxsf+xsbH/sbGx/66u | |
156 rv+kpKT/ioqK/2RjYf+QlJL/z9XT/4iLif9SUUz/VlRQzwAAAACFioj//////+zs7P/s7Oz/7Ozs/+zs | |
157 7P/s7Oz/4uLi/6qqqv9sc3L/yc7L/6itqv9eYF3/dXd0/HR1cf8AAAAAhYqI///////b29v/sbGx/7Gx | |
158 sf+xsbH/sbGx/6Wlpf9aW1r/rLCu/7G2tP9cXl7/XmJh/05OS+tQUE36AAAAAIWKiP//////7Ozs/+zs | |
159 7P/s7Oz/7Ozs/+zs7P/l5eX/x8fH/3h3df9ERUP/kpKS/32BgP9OTk4uRkZFPgAAAACFioj/6+vr/wCg | |
160 xP+8vLz/AKDE/7i4uP8AoMT/uLi4/wCdwP+pqan/AJGy/4CFg/+Fioj/Tk5OAU5OTgIAAAAAhYqI/wCg | |
161 xP89sev/AKDE/z2x6/8AoMT/PbHr/wCgxP89sev/AKDE/z2x6/8AoMT/hYqI/wAAAAAAAAAAAAAAAAAA | |
162 AAAAoMT/xuj5/wCgxP/G6Pn/AKDE/8bo+f8AoMT/xuj5/wCgxP/G6Pn/AKDE/wAAAAAAAAAAAAAAAAAA | |
163 AAAAAAAAAAAAAACgxP8AAAAAAKDE/wAAAAAAoMT/AAAAAACgxP8AAAAAAKDE/wAAAAAAAAAAAAAAAAAA | |
164 A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A | |
165 AAAAAAAAgAMAAIADAACAAQAAgAEAAIAAAACAAAAAgAAAAIAAAACAAAAAgAAAAIADAACAAwAAgAMAAMAH | |
166 ///qr////////w== | |
167 </value> | |
168 </data> | |
169 </root> |